The Pharmacy Technician - Operating Room, Evenings supports one of Cleveland Clinic's highest-volume inpatient pharmacy operations at Main Campus, with a primary focus on serving the operating room while collaborating across multiple inpatient service lines, including oncology, sterile products, pediatrics, and general inpatient care. Caregivers receive comprehensive training and support daily pharmacy operations through medication preparation and distribution, medication deliveries throughout Main Campus, automated carousel operations, phone triage, and management of MAR messaging to assist inpatient care teams. This active role requires frequent travel throughout the hospital and offers extensive cross-training opportunities. Upon successful completion of training and demonstrated competencies, caregivers may have the opportunity to transfer into one of several specialized pharmacy areas, including IV services, ambulatory pharmacy, specialty pharmacy, and home care, based on departmental needs.
A caregiver in this position works either a variable or evening schedule based on the role. Variable shift caregivers rotate between 6:45am to 3:15pm and 2:00pm to 10:30pm, typically working three weeks on day shift followed by one week on evening shift. Evening shift caregivers work 2:00pm to 10:30pm. Both schedules include an every third weekend rotation.
A caregiver who excels in this role will:
- Prepare medications through selecting, labeling, repacking, non-sterilecompoundingand sterile compounding.
- Deliver medications to theappropriate storagelocations inan accurateandtimelymanner.
- Maintainaccurateandappropriate inventoriesof medications and supplies and complete inventory audits, such as cycle counts and nursing unit inspections.
- Maintain a safe and clean work area bycomplying withprocedures, rules and regulations, anddocumentregulatory requirements such as temperature logs, scheduledactivitiesand training.
- Use information systems,technologyand automation to complete assigned tasks.
- Assistwiththe training ofpharmacycaregiversand students.
Minimum qualifications for the ideal future caregiver include:
- High School Diploma/GED
- Upon hire, must be a Certified Pharmacy Technician (CPhT) through the Pharmacy Technician Certification Board (PTCB) or the National HealthCareer Association (NHA).
- Upon hire, it is required to hold an active registration through the Ohio Board of Pharmacy (OBOP) as either a Certified Pharmacy Technician, Registered Pharmacy Technician, or Pharmacy Technician Trainee.
- Caregivers with active Pharmacy Technician Trainee or Registered Pharmacy Technician registrations are required to update their registration to a Certified Pharmacy Technician registration with the OBOP within 6 months.
Preferred qualifications for the ideal future caregiver include:
- Six months of hospital experience
- Completion of a formal pharmacy technician training program
